Bug Description

issue started recently - used to work without any problems in the past - i started observing this in collection 9.2.0
we run deployment from ISO where ISO is mounted for default 120min
as deployments usually finish faster, we have process to reset idrac in order to unmount the ISO from iDrac after deployment is done
recently we started getting error "Lifecycle controller status check is InUse after 50 number of retries, Exiting.."

Steps to Reproduce

run task to put idrac into the InUse state
run task to try reset idrac

Expected Behavior

expected is to have idrac reset

Actual Behavior

error message - Lifecycle controller status check is InUse after 50 number of retries, Exiting..
and module fail state
